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
532600 94507 02619
672 66383053
672 66383053
936065 758 71
All about undefined
Interested in learning more?
672 66383053
936065 758 71
See more
1286051 80724 589640976
189399355 950 9883 8550947
See more
9650 16405
35644 8008548 758 40 4913332573
See more